Are there different variations or designs of the Spiderman bodysuit throughout the comics and movies?
Spiderman is one of the most iconic superheroes of all time. Known for his web-slinging abilities and distinctive red and blue bodysuit, Spiderman has captured the imaginations of fans for decades. But did you know that there are actually many different variations and designs of the Spiderman bodysuit throughout the comics and movies?
In the comics, Spiderman's costume has gone through several changes over the years. The original design, created by artist Steve Ditko, featured a red and blue suit with webbing patterns and a large black spider emblem on the chest. This classic design has become synonymous with the character and is often referred to as the "classic" or "original" suit.
However, as the comics evolved and new storylines were introduced, so too did Spiderman's attire. One notable variation is the black symbiote suit, which was introduced in the "Secret Wars" storyline. This suit, which was actually an alien symbiote that bonded with Peter Parker, featured a sleek black design with white spider symbols on the chest and back. This suit became incredibly popular with fans and eventually led to the creation of the character Venom.
In addition to the black symbiote suit, there have been many other variations of Spiderman's costume in the comics. Some designs featured subtle changes to the color scheme or webbing patterns, while others introduced entirely new elements, such as additional gadgets or armored plating. These variations often corresponded to different storylines or alternate universes, allowing writers and artists to explore different interpretations of the character.

Where can someone find and purchase a Spiderman bodysuit to wear for cosplay or costume purposes?
When it comes to dressing up as Spiderman for cosplay or costume purposes, finding and purchasing a spiderman bodysuit is an essential step. The iconic red and blue suit is a signature look of the superhero and is beloved by fans worldwide. In this article, we will explore different avenues where one can find and purchase a Spiderman bodysuit.
- Online Retailers: One of the easiest and most convenient ways to find and purchase a Spiderman bodysuit is through online retailers. Websites like Amazon, eBay, and Etsy offer a wide variety of options to choose from. These platforms have a range of sellers, including both established brands and independent vendors, who specialize in selling cosplay costumes. It is important to read customer reviews and check the seller's ratings before making a purchase to ensure a good buying experience.
- Costume Stores: Many cities have costume stores that offer a range of costumes and accessories for various occasions, including cosplay. These stores often have a dedicated section for superhero costumes, including Spiderman. Visiting a physical store allows you to try on different sizes and styles to find the one that fits you best. Additionally, store employees can provide valuable advice and recommendations based on your needs.
- Comic Conventions and Fan Events: Comic conventions and fan events are a great place to find unique and high-quality Spiderman bodysuits. Many vendors and artists set up booths at these events, offering a plethora of cosplay merchandise. You can find everything from professionally crafted costumes to hand-made, one-of-a-kind pieces. These events also provide an opportunity to meet fellow Spiderman enthusiasts and get inspiration for your costume.
- Custom-Made: If you have a specific vision for your Spiderman bodysuit or are unable to find the right size or style in existing options, consider getting a custom-made suit. There are several costume makers and tailors who specialize in creating custom cosplay costumes. This option allows you to add personal touches, such as specific fabric choices or extra detailing, to make your costume truly unique. However, custom-made suits can be more expensive and may require additional time for production.
- DIY: Another option is to create your own Spiderman bodysuit through DIY (Do-It-Yourself) methods. This requires basic sewing skills and access to a sewing machine. Many online tutorials and patterns are available that guide you through the process of creating a Spiderman costume from scratch. This option allows for complete creative control and can be a rewarding experience for individuals who enjoy crafting and sewing.
